Storage

Partitions

Commande Action
fdisk -l <disk> Affiche les partitions
parted <disk> print Affiche les partitions GPT
sfdisk -l <disk> Affiche les partitions
sfdisk -l <disk> -d > parts.sav Sauvegarde la table des partitions
sfdisk -l <disk> < parts.sav Restaure la table des partitions

RAID

Commande Action
cat /proc/mdstat Affiche les RAID
mdadm --detail <path-to-md> Affiche les détails pour le RAID

Formatage

Commande Action
mkfs.ext4 <PartitionPath> Formate en ext4
e2fsck -f [-y] <PartitionPath> Vérifie le FS
resize2fs -f <PartitionPath> [<size>G] Redimensionne le FS

Montage

Commande Action
mount Affiche la liste des montages
mount <LogicalVolPath> <mountPoint> Monte le volume

SMART

Nom du paquet à installer sur Debian : smartmontools.

# smartctl --all /dev/sda

Restaurer un fichier supprimé

  • photorec (package testdisk)
  • testdisk
  • extundelete (exemple extundelete /dev/vdb --restore-all)

Autre

Pour activer l’ajout de disque à chaud : echo "- - -" > /sys/class/scsi_host/host2/scan.

Supprimer la réservation d’espace disque pour root : tune2fs -m 0 /dev/sda1